She was born Sept. 9, 1914, in Greenview, the daughter of John H. and Emma Amerkamp Evers. She married Victor Berger McAtee in 1937 in Greenview; he died in 1989.
Mrs. McAtee worked for the secretary of state’s office for several years. She was a member of Greenview United Church, where she was a member of Women’s Fellowship.
Survivors: son, Don (wife, Janet) McAtee of Greenview; daughter, Eleanor (husband, Steve) Bergman of Mason City; six grandchildren; four great-grandchildren; and brother, Lawrence (wife, Darlene) Evers of Greenview.
Services: 11 a.m. Thursday, Greenview United Church, the Rev. Stephen King officiating. Burial: Elmwood Cemetery, Greenview.
Hurley Funeral Home in Mason City is in charge of arrangements.
